## Further Reading

This repo contains the tooling built during the Pendulum cron drift investigation, when scheduled jobs on the Oakmere cluster slipped by up to ninety seconds per day. Maintainers should understand the NTP stepping behavior and the scheduler tick analysis before changing anything here. The raw timing captures and the final root-cause writeup are archived separately. For the full investigation notes and remediation history, see the internal page below.

runbook for badug-kadup: https://confluence.zemvarlabs.internal/projects/browse/display/projects/bd1b

**Vendor note — Stockmend reconciliation job**

The nightly reconciliation against Harbridge Supply's inventory feed is vendor-maintained code; we only own the adapter layer. Please review the adapter's retry and idempotency handling carefully, since duplicate adjustments have caused ledger drift before. Do not modify the vendor module directly — changes must go through Harbridge's change process. Questions about the feed contract should go to their integration desk.

escalation mailbox, yajeg-bageg: quenax.olidor@lumiccorp.internal

## NightLoader Backfill Scheduler — Onboarding

NightLoader schedules nightly data backfills for the Corvet analytics platform. Jobs are defined declaratively, queued at 01:00 local, and executed by stateless workers with at-most-once semantics. For the security review: workers authenticate to the job store via short-lived credentials, and all job definitions are audit-logged. Failed runs are retried twice, then quarantined. To inspect the job store and audit tables directly, use the connection string below.

replica DSN, kajep-yahag: mssql://praok_svc:iF@db-8d68.plorvaio.local:5432/eliion

### Step 4: Enable the FareSplit pricing experiment

Before enabling FareSplit in production, confirm the experiment flag service is reachable and that price overrides are logged to the audit stream — the security review depends on that trail. Rollout is capped at 10% of Norwick-region traffic initially. The experiment runs with the following configuration.

service settings:
HOLIX_HOST=holix.qorvelsys.internal
HOLIX_PORT=7000